Output 57fe51993a00bed0c829817fbcc52b22f4a2e348ef41cd31614485224dc830dc:3

value
32462659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ccd109b5a38793ddb562ca7427130a9615031fc OP_EQUAL
address
M94qztXKs5zVoykbjiZFr5s2uMUapHBuTK
transaction
57fe51993a00bed0c829817fbcc52b22f4a2e348ef41cd31614485224dc830dc
spent
true